Responsibilities:

  • Draft and review a variety of real estate documents including purchase agreements, deeds, easements, and other documents related to land acquisitions and dispositions.
  • Conduct comprehensive title and survey reviews on properties, identifying any potential issues and proposing appropriate solutions.
  • Assist in the preparation and review of legal documents, ensuring compliance with all relevant laws and regulations.
  • Participate in real estate transactions, coordinating with various parties including attorneys, clients, and other stakeholders.
  • Conduct legal research and provide legal support related to land use, zoning, and other real estate matters.
  • Assist in the preparation of reports and presentations for senior management, clients, and other stakeholders.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of relevant laws, regulations, and industry trends, providing advice and guidance as necessary.
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Law, Business, or related field is required.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ience as a paralegal, preferably in the real estate or construction industry.
  • Strong knowledge of real estate law, particularly in relation to land acquisitions, title and survey work, and legal document drafting.
  • Excellent legal research and writing skills.
  • Strong organ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ple tasks and projects simultaneously.
  •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ively as part of a team and build strong relationships with clients and other stakeholders.
  • Proficiency in the use of Microsoft Office Suite and legal research tools.
  • Paralegal certification is preferred.
